I had the acid reflux and indigestion, but it only seemed to flair up around the time of my period. I had mirena removed after 6 months. I am 5mo post removal, I found out through an EGD that my esophagus and stomach was inflammed. (aka acid reflux and gastritis) I started taking prilosec and changed my diet tremedously which helped a bunch. I gave up most soda and caffeine for one. I cut back a bunch on spicy food. I eat a ton more wholegrains, fresh fruit and veggies. The prilosec helped a bunch but it increased my dizziness so I had to quit taking it after about 3 weeks. A few organic, natual things to try are to eat pure liquid honey by the teaspoon full on an empty stomach. It coats your esophagus and stomach and has an anti-inflammatory property to it. Also, the best cure for me is to eat red delicious apples. If I eat part of one at the end of my meals and one a little while before bed on my bad days it really helps me. This sound crazy, but it works for me. Best of luck. I'll pray for your healing.
